Location / Time: Meet at St Vital Park Duck Pond in the large parking lot closest to the Duck Pond building (washrooms), ready to start cycling at 10:30 AM.

Description:
From St Vital Park Duck Pond, ride through part of St Vital, over the Elm Park bridge, then via Jubilee, Harrow, Wellington Crescent, Empress, Silver, Yellow Ribbon Greenway, Hamilton, and Sturgeon Creek Creenway to Grant’s Old Mill (washrooms) for a lunch break. Then onward across the Assiniboine River, through the Assiniboine Forest and Fort Whyte Alive, onto Awasisak Meskanow Greenway, and into St Vital Park back to the starting point.
Route map (It shows an incorrect extra 4.5K at Fort Whyte Alive)
44K distance. ~4 hours including the lunch break.
The ride will be cancelled in the event of rain or strong wind.

Bring: Helmet, water, a bagged lunch, and your name tag.
